Here are some pics of my newest find, A Zenith Trans-Oceanic 8G005yt from 1947-48. I normally don't have an interest in post war sets, but I just fixed a 1953 H-500 TO for a friend and kind of got an urge to get one for myself. I wanted an earlier version thoughIcon_rolleyes! I decided on this version as it is an 8 tube model with all loktal tubes and a push pull amplifier, which I think is pretty neat seeing as it's a "portable" setIcon_lol! i wasn't too crazy about the Ebay prices until I came across this one with a "But it now" price of $19.95! It wasn't listed there for longIcon_lol!!! After a few anxious days it arrived here undamaged today. I very happy with it, as it is in very good original condition with all of it's accesories.

One problem these tend to have (I've had several, and it's been about 60-40) is that the output transformer ends up being open. Cross your fingers.

Those output transformers tend to be hard to replace as they have a high primary impedance like 10-20K. Same as some of the Philco farm sets.
